I already replied to your thread about it, but I'll copy/paste my response here:
Well, I pretty much already voiced my opinion on this, but I've always felt that Dynomat is overpriced and pretty much the same as the rest of the sound deadening materials. Although I really haven't compared prices between them and others recently, so perhaps their prices have come more in line with other companies. Second Skin definitely seemed like pretty high quality material, at least compared to Elemental Design's. I like ED's products a lot, but Second Skin's quality of deadening material seems way better.
